The 3-Axis Accelerometer has three separate internal accelerometers mounted orthogonally, allowing you to analyze separate components of complex accelerations.

Description

The 3-Axis Accelerometer consists of three –5 to +5 g accelerometers mounted in one small block. Using the appropriate data collection hardware and software, you can graph any of these components, or calculate the magnitude of the net acceleration. The 3-Axis Accelerometer can be used for a wide variety of experiments and demonstrations, both inside the lab and outside.

Specifications

  • Power: 30 mA @ 5 VDC
  • Range: ±49 m/s2 (±5 g)
  • Accuracy: ±0.5 m/s2 (±0.05 g)
  • Frequency Response: 0–100 Hz
  • Resolution: 0.037 m/s²
